Hybrid power systems
A hybrid power system refers to a combination of two or more modes of electricity generation that usually integrate renewable sources of power such as wind turbines or solar photovoltaic (PV). The idea behind combining different generation technologies is to offer a higher level of energy security and guarantee maximum supply at all times.

What is a hybrid energy system?
A hybrid energy system, or hybrid power, usually consists of two or more renewable energy sources used together to provide increased system efficiency as well as greater balance in energy supply. [ 5 ] Floating solar is usually added to existing hydro rather than building both together.
How do hybrid power systems work?
Hybrid power systems merge two or more means of electricity generation mutually and generally by means of renewable sources like SPV and wind turbines as shown in Fig. 1. The two energy sources used mutually provide better system efficiency, lower cost, and superior energy supply balance .

What is a hybrid power System (HPS)?
Hybrid power systems (HPS) assure continuous power supply to the end users. These systems consist of more than one energy source like wind-diesel, solar photovoltaic-diesel, wind-photovoltaic, and wind-photovoltaic-diesel, with and without battery backup.

How can a hybrid energy storage system help a power grid?
The intermittent nature of standalone renewable sources can strain existing power grids, causing frequency and voltage fluctuations . By incorporating hybrid systems with energy storage capabilities, these fluctuations can be better managed, and surplus energy can be injected into the grid during peak demand periods.
